Commercial roof evaluation services involve a thorough inspection of a building’s roofing system to assess its current condition. These evaluations typically include examining the roof’s surface for signs of damage, such as cracks, blisters, or punctures, as well as checking for issues related to drainage, flashing, and structural integrity. Service providers may also inspect areas like roof penetrations, seams, and vents to identify potential vulnerabilities. The goal is to gather detailed information about the roof’s overall health and identify any immediate repairs or maintenance needed to prevent future problems.
This type of evaluation helps address common roofing issues such as leaks, ponding water, deterioration of roofing materials, or structural weaknesses. Identifying these problems early can prevent costly repairs or even the need for a complete roof replacement. Additionally, a comprehensive assessment can uncover underlying issues that might not be visible from the ground, such as hidden water damage or insulation problems. These evaluations are especially useful for property owners who want to extend the life of their roof, plan for renovations, or ensure their building remains compliant with safety standards.
Commercial properties that frequently utilize roof evaluation services include office buildings, retail centers, warehouses, industrial facilities, and multi-family complexes. These structures often have flat or low-slope roofs that are more susceptible to ponding and drainage issues, making regular inspections essential. Property managers and business owners rely on evaluations to maintain their investments, avoid unexpected downtime, and ensure the safety of tenants and employees. Even smaller commercial properties can benefit from periodic assessments to catch minor issues before they develop into major repairs.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Roof Evaluation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Upland,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Repairs - typical costs for minor roof repairs in Upland, CA range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, like patching leaks or replacing small sections, fall within this range. Larger or more complex repairs may exceed this, but they are less common in this category.
Moderate Repairs - projects such as replacing sections of flashing or addressing extensive damage usually cost between $600 and $2,500. Many local contractors handle these jobs within this band, though costs can vary based on roof size and material.
Roof Coatings and Maintenance - applying roof coatings or performing maintenance typically costs between $1,000 and $3,500. These services are common for extending roof life and usually fall into the middle of this range, with larger properties pushing costs higher.
Full Roof Replacement - complete roof replacements in Upland often range from $7,000 to $15,000+, depending on the size, materials, and complexity. Many projects land in the mid to upper part of this range, while larger or more intricate jobs can reach beyond $20,000.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a commercial roof evaluation? A commercial roof evaluation involves a thorough inspection of a building's roofing system to identify potential issues, damage, or areas needing maintenance, helping property owners make informed decisions about repairs or replacements.
Why should a business consider a roof evaluation? Regular roof evaluations can help detect problems early, prevent costly repairs, and ensure the roof remains in good condition to protect the building and its contents.
What types of issues can a roof evaluation uncover? A roof evaluation can reveal issues such as leaks, membrane damage, ponding water, structural weaknesses, or deterioration of roofing materials that may compromise the roof’s integrity.
How do local contractors perform a commercial roof evaluation? Local contractors typically conduct visual inspections, assess roofing materials, check for signs of wear or damage, and may use specialized tools to evaluate the roof’s condition accurately.
When is the best time to schedule a roof evaluation? It’s advisable to schedule evaluations during mild weather conditions, such as spring or fall, to ensure a clear assessment of the roof’s condition without the interference of extreme weather.
